TRENTON - Thelma Greenidge Taitt, "Tookie," age 75, of Trenton, passed away on Wednesday Feb. 9, 2011.She was born in New York City, N.Y. on May 9, 1935. Thelma was the daughter of Vivian and stepdaughter of Samuel Gass. A lifelong resident of Trenton, Thelma was an elementary school teacher at...
